If you’re planning to sell, then you’ll want to know the latest technique in how to best promote your home for sale. Research shows that a potential buyer has formed an opinion on your home within the first 20 seconds of entering the front door. First impressions are important, especially when it’s time to sell. In fact, the way you live in your home and the way to sell your home are two different things.

Studies have shown that "staging" your home will greatly influence the interest it generates with buyers and Realtors, leading to a higher sale price with less time on the market. When your home is prepared for sale with care and intention, prospective buyers will feel the difference, making it easier for them to visualize living there.

Our objective is to accentuate the features of the home by depersonalizing and neutralizing the space to broaden its appeal. We’ll highlight the focal points of each room and improve traffic flow, making the home feel welcoming, inviting, airy and open because the longer you can keep a potential buyer in your home during a showing, the more likely you are to have positive results. They will feel as if they are touring their new home, instead of visiting yours. ReDesign for Staging

Buyers need to make a positive emotional connection to a house. Surprisingly enough, many buyers are unable to look past minor cosmetic issues when viewing. If they walk through a house and don’t like the furniture or the decorating style, they probably won’t like the house either.
